Early Detection: A Crucial Defense Against Losses
Early detection isn't just about minimizing losses—it's a proactive push towards emerging unscathed from potential threats.
Timely identification of fraudulent activities allows businesses to halt wrongdoing before it balloons into irrecoverable loss.
Research shows frauds detected within a six-month window incur significantly lower losses than those unnoticed for longer durations.
